2. Scope and Checklist

Next, develop a detailed checklist or scope of work for your remodel. This list should include every aspect of the renovation, from layout changes to specific materials and finishes. Use a printable kitchen renovation checklist template to ensure you cover all bases. A clear checklist will help you stay focused on your needs and make it easier for contractors to provide accurate bids.

3. Budget

Understanding the costs associated with a kitchen remodel is essential. Research local kitchen renovation costs and gather estimates from contractors to get a sense of your project's price range. Be flexible with your choices to stay within budget and anticipate additional costs by setting aside 10-20% for unexpected expenses. Sharing your budget with contractors upfront will help them tailor their estimates accordingly.

4. Kitchen Design and Layout

With a budget in mind, focus on the design and layout of your kitchen. Start by selecting the most crucial elements like cabinets and appliances, as these will influence the overall layout. Consider visiting material stores and suppliers to find the exact finishes you like. If needed, hire a professional kitchen designer to create a functional and beautiful layout. Remember, expanding the kitchen footprint or relocating appliances can increase costs.

5. Meet at Least Three Contractors

Finding the right contractor is vital for a successful remodel. Meet with at least three contractors, sharing your project scope and budget with each. This will help you gauge their communication style, expertise, and suitability for your project. 6. Vet & Select Contractor, Sign Agreement

Once you’ve met with potential contractors, vet them thoroughly. Check online reviews, verify licenses, obtain insurance certificates, contact references, and interview the company owner. Select the contractor that best fits your budget and communication style. Ensure the written agreement includes the scope of work, cost, and payment schedule. A well-defined contract will help prevent misunderstandings and keep the project on track.

7. Kitchen Plans & Blueprints

For projects involving structural changes, work with an architect or designer to create detailed plans and blueprints. These plans may require approval from local authorities, so allow time for this process. Detailed plans ensure that all aspects of the remodel are considered and executed correctly, maintaining the structural integrity of your home.

8. Select & Purchase Materials

Prioritize the selection and purchase of essential materials early in the process. Start with cabinets and appliances, as their sizes and locations will dictate the layout. Follow with flooring, tile, sinks, and countertops, considering lead times for delivery. Selecting and ordering materials in advance prevents delays and ensures everything is ready when needed.

9. Schedule the Project in Advance and Prepare for Construction

Schedule your project well in advance, considering contractor availability and lead times for materials. Prepare your home for construction by setting up a temporary kitchen space. Plan for daily living arrangements, as you’ll be without a kitchen for several weeks. Organizing these details beforehand will help minimize disruption during the renovation.

10. Construction

The construction phase begins with careful demolition and dust control. Maintain open communication with your contractor, addressing any concerns promptly. Regular inspections and a final punch list will ensure a satisfactory completion of the project. Once the construction is complete, thoroughly clean the new kitchen and check that all appliances are working properly before making the final payment.

Maintenance and Longevity Tips

Congratulations! You’ve successfully completed your kitchen remodel. To maintain its beauty and functionality, follow these tips:

  • Regularly clean surfaces with mild, non-abrasive cleaners.
  • Inspect for leaks, loose handles, or signs of wear and tear.
  • Follow the care instructions for your materials and appliances.
  • Use protective measures like soft-close hinges and floor mats.
  • Ensure proper ventilation to prevent humidity damage.
  • Address issues promptly to avoid escalation.
  • Schedule regular servicing for specialized appliances.

By following these maintenance tips, you’ll preserve the beauty and functionality of your kitchen for years to come.
